Jim Macmahon
Jim Macmahon and Debra Macmahon breed Percheron horses in Newport, NH, within Sullivan County and the Lakes Region near Concord. They are active members of the Percheron Breeders of America and follow its registry guidelines, ensuring each horse undergoes routine health screenings before placement. Their farm provides spacious pastures with shade and shelter, as well as daily handling from foalhood to support a calm temperament and sound development.
They draw on decades of draft horse experience, blending natural horsemanship techniques with careful selection for strength and temperament. Local owners often mention the horses’ steady disposition, even in training for light farm work or driving. Their long-term focus on reliable bloodlines and animal welfare sustains a consistent standard across every foal. A selection of older mares and geldings is available for light draft work, riding, or therapeutic programs in neighboring farms.
